Preferred Field(s) of Study: (BSc/B.Com/B.Tech/BE/MBA/M.Tech/Msc)Minimum Year(s) of Experience (BQ) *: 2-4 yearsMinimum of 2 year(s) of experience working with QA Testing skills.Certification(s) Preferred: ISTQBPreferred Knowledge/Skills *:Strong problem solving and analytical skills.Ability to leverage critical thinking skills to bring order to unstructured problems.Ability to actively participate in reviews of User Stories (functional and technical) in order to identify and help bridge gaps in requirements - particularly around use-cases and workflows (including considerations such as happy path, alternate paths, user-error, system-error workflows, etc.).Working closely with the Business and QA leads to obtain a thorough understanding of the application and the business being supported by the application.Working closely with Interactions Hub Developers / Solution Architect / Technical Lead to understand the technical approach, technical specifications, and non-functional requirements that are integral to the software application.Ability to author Agile Test Plans and Requirements Traceability Matrices to ensure testing depth (i.e., number of test cases) and breadth (i.e., types of test cases) are commensurate with the number of story points/ complexity and effort intensiveness of the functionalities being developed and tested.Ability to collaborate with the Interactions Hub Business and Development teams to ensure accuracy in level of effort estimation of user stories (e.g., via creation of standardized and/or specific QA tasks to justify QA level of effort estimations).Proficiency in the use of test management tools like JIRA, XRAY, etc.Ability to organize and lead test-set peer reviews, test plan reviews, execution of test runsAbility to organize / lead efforts to log and actively seek quick resolution of bugs (based on their severity and priority).Ability to drive continuous improvement from conducting Root Cause Analysis of bugs / issues.Ability to work in a cross functional team in a dynamic work environment while managing stakeholder expectations and scope.Ability to work as part of Scrum/ Kanban Agile teams in a multi-pod fast paced environmentAbility to work with team members across multiple locations/ timezonesDemonstrated ability to advocate and uphold the standards, best practices and protocols outlined in a Quality Assurance and Testing Framework.Experience testing workflow applications built on the Appian platform preferred by not required
